Pie charts are a common means of visualizing data, emphasizing the proportions of different categories within a whole. A pie chart displays the relative sizes of each category by segmenting a circle according to the frequency of occurrence or percentage within a dataset. **Understanding Basic Concepts**
Before diving into the technical aspects, it’s crucial to understand the essentials of pie charts:

1. **Purpose**: Pie charts are most useful for showing the relationship of parts to a whole, making them ideal for datasets representing percentages or share of the total.

2. **Limitations**: They should be used sparingly, often not exceeding five to seven categories because the human eye struggles to accurately interpret the size of slices when there are too many sections.

3. **Data Representation**: Each sector corresponds to a particular category’s share of the whole. This representation is highly effective when comparing the sizes of categories visually.
